Episode 31 - Anthony Koutoufides


“In 94 when I got dropped for 2 weeks, the club asked whether I wanted see a sports psychologist by the name of Anthony Stuart and I said whatever it takes for me to get back I’m going to do this, so I went down to see him and he taught me these words; I can, I will, you just watch me and I highlighted them in my diary every day, those words changed my life”

My special guest is Anthony Koutoufides. Kouta is a former legend of AFL having played 278 senior games for Carlton. Away from sport he is forging a path in health & wellness.​

You will learn plenty from Anthony Koutoufides in episode 31 of the Talking with TK Podcast.
